Indexing pdf files php

Apache poi is a more general document handling project inside apache. What is the best way to index the fulltext of several. The table of contents of a book helps a reader to instantly locate. If you dont find these options on the ui, recheck your acrobat product. Extracting text from individual pages or whole pdf document files in php is easy using the pdftotext class. Indexing of office files meaning objectives essentials. Fulltext search plugin is developed specifically for wordpress. If youre working with php codesniffer in your wordpress project, then youre likely familiar with how much time it takes to complete indexing all php files you start up your ide, configure phpcs, point it to your set of wordpress rules, and then wait for it to begin doing its job. Tags outlook howto 31 replies to indexing and searching pdf content using windows search. There are a number of reasons pdf indexing can fail. Locate32 saves to a database the names of all files on your hard drives. Full text search pdf, doc, docx and other are available. Pdf and doc files can be indexed via external binaries. For a broader discussion about cataloging and indexing, see this article.

The php doc docx pdf to text class can make any document easy to search. First you have to include an external php file named class. Read pdf file and show the contents of the file on browser. A php search engine called sphider has the option of adding pdf search via xpdf.

If you are getting php errors, you might need to specify the path of your php configuration file. A pdf file is a distilled version of a postscript file, adding structure and efficiency. Thus, when you want to create index for your pdf files, you really do not have to do so much on your part. All i need to do on merging pdf files in linux the iis server to enable pdf indexing. It will extract file contents using apache tika and send it to elasticsearch for indexing.

But when i trying to search text from pdf or docx in a folder its not working. There are known issues when trying to view pdf files in windows 8. It includes searching, icons for each file type, an admin panel, uploads, access logging, file descriptions, and more. If youre prompted for an administrator password or. Whether you use this computer for business or personal use, there will definitely be many pdf files saved. On behalf of a friend who wants help with his business, we are just wanting to know if anyone is aware of any low hassle ways of indexing pdf files, that are scanned images of text. Attachmentpdfdoc indexing and searching on elasticsearch. Pdf index generator is a powerful indexing utility for generating the back of your book index and writing it to your book in 4 easy steps. Major frustrations with indexing pdf content drupal. Php files might actually be media files or images that were accidentally named with the. Indexing php files does not search php file zoom search. However, i want a php script which i can set as the index file on some directories that will automatically make a list of the files in that dir. Click build, and then specify the location for the index file.

How to search for text inside multiple pdf files at once. Open indexing options by clicking the start button, and then clicking control panel. How can php read pdf file content and extract text from. The type file attribute of the tag shows the input field as a fileselect control, with a browse button next to the input control. Authors can submit contents to be indexed in this site using the form provided below. My site has thousands of pdf files that were uploaded as both attachments in basic pages and as file nodes in drupal 8.

Index multiple pdfs and do full text advanced searches using. If you stop the indexing process, you cannot resume the same indexing session but you dont have to redo the work. The right system of indexing must be chosen in order to achieve the objectives of indexing. To just know about indexing pdf files, see this section in the article. Once the file indexing has occurred, you can locate files quickly by using the applications search form. Enable this option to create excerpts from custom field content, including the pdf file contents which are stored in a custom field. Instructor justin yost discusses how to think about performance optimization, measure the performance of your php software, test to ensure youre not losing users to a slow page load, optimize your database queries, and more. Dec 07, 2017 you can use phrases for pdf content as well. Indexing is a data structure technique to efficiently retrieve records from database files based on some attributes on which the indexing has been done.

The purpose of indexing the electronic documents is similar to the function played by an index or table of contents in a book. Wordpress search function indexing pdf files solutions. I wasnt able to find an alternative to adobe acrobats indexing capabilities on linux and it appears thats because embedded indexes still arent part of open pdf standards however, there are a number of very powerful desktop search engines out there that are both faster and more efficient in pdf indexing than adobes proprietary tools. Pdf index generator parses your book, collects the index. It is a very good tool for creating a big database of books online where you can use the text of this documents to be crawled by search engines. In this course, learn about a variety of tools and techniques for developing highperforming php software. To turn on the file contents indexing, follow these steps. In the search box, type indexing options, and then click indexing options. A pdf file can be created by acrobat distiller or a special printer driver program called a pdfwriter. The primary reason is that the built in, php based pdf content extraction method was not able to extract content from your pdf, resulting in an empty searchwp file content box. Full text search pdf and more wordpress plugin to extend. There are several frameworks for extracting text suitable for lucene indexing from rich text files pdf, ppt etc.

That way we can use the text and save to a database and have the database server perform the searches using query parameters, or we can perform the searches we want to do directly in the text using php code. A person can index these files together in order to locate any file at any time. Major frustrations with indexing pdf content drupal reddit. Set windows 10 to search all file contents with this setting. Normally, you dont necessarily need to use any server side scripting language like php to download images, zip files, pdf documents, exe files, etc. Here, the role of indexing portable document format comes into play. Submit your pdf documents to icdst repository indexing authors edocuments. I love having it sniff the code while writing it, but it also takes a bit of.

Because pdf files have certainly become very popular in use, there would definitely be so many pdf files stored in just about any personal computer. Automatically assign metadata and upload to any document management system. If any of these files do not exist, you should run php installation and install appropriate modules mbstring or php zip respectively. One of them is apache tika, a subproject of lucene. You can reduce the time required to search a long pdf by embedding an index of the words in the document. Once windows search finishes building the index, you should be able to search for the contents within pdf file by simply typing the text in the search box. Indexing multiple files is possible in acrobat professional only and not in acrobat standard. Net framework and allows the distribution of files across. Icdst eprint archive of engineering and scientific pdf. Indexing and searching pdf content using windows search. Acrobat can search the index much faster than it can search the document. How to force download files using php tutorial republic. Full text search pdf and more wordpress plugin to extend search.

Im not sure any of the pdf readers support text indexing probably because the indexing itself would be rather expensive and pdf files opened and closed adhoc however, ive done some testing and can see that okular the default viewer from kde has much faster search than evince the default viewer from ubuntu. To start viewing messages, select the forum that you want to visit from the selection below. Create a html form, from where u can choose your pdf file from any location. Follow the steps below to add pdf files to the index so you can search in windows by that file type. Dbms indexing we know that information in the dbms files is stored in form of records. In those cases, just rename the file extension to the right one and then it should open correctly in the program that displays that file type, such as a video player if youre working with an mp4 file. Indexing a document is the process of entering information into a database that will later be used to search for documents. But we are looking into using something like this ourselves for some simple pdf indexing. If we want to search docx, doc and pdf files we need first to extract the text they contain. Without the requirements above, the file upload will not work.

Text finding supports you to find specific content within pdf files. The crawler collects and indexes documents that are freely and publicly available and accessible. The primary reason is that the built in, phpbased pdf content extraction method was not able to extract content from your pdf, resulting in an empty searchwp file content box. Indexing continues until there are no further permitted links to follow. Every record is equipped with some key field, which helps it to be recognized uniquely. Read this article that is the first of a series that will teach you about the challenge of processing the pdf file format and how the pdftotext class can be used to extract text and images from it. Even if you may not remember the files name, or you just remembe one or two keyword phrases in a file, text finding has strong featurse to help you effectively search the files with a small. Im trying to find a way to search inside pdf files. How to index files in windows 10 to speed up searches. To block files of a specific file type for example. The following are the essential features of a good system of indexing. It works like updatedb and locate commands in unix. Unsing text finding, you can freely adjust the speed of index creating by moving the speed button, which can let you index the files in your defined scope within a second.

Locate32 finds files and directories based on file and folder names stored in a database. Stop indexing all php files in php codesniffer tom mcfarlin. In general, indexing refers to the organization of data according to a specific schema or plan. An indexing system should be simple to understand and. To index specific files, type indexing in the windows 10 start menu and the first match should be the indexing options control panel applet as shown below. How to index files in windows 10 to speed up searches toms. Autoindex php script directory indexer autoindex is a php script that makes a table that lists the files in a directory, and lets users access the files and subdirectories. Its called ambar it can easy index billions of pdfs no matter what format its have, even do an ocr on images in pdf.

Get the full version of this sample in your pdf extractor sdk free trial in index pdf files folder. Indexing is not required if files are arranged in an alphabetical order. The wordpress search only looks at the various mysql tables that contain content and will not index the contents of any pdf or other document attachment. How to prevent a pdf file from being indexed by search. In it, the term has various similar uses including, among other things, making information more presentable and accessible. The application will then proceed to indexing your pdf files, just as you have specified in your settings. It will show the progress of processing the search indexing queue. Idra indexing and retrieving automatically is a tool which allows indexing a wide range of text txt, doc, pdf and image annotations files xml, querybased searching, visualizing an index, saving it for reusability, evaluation, etc.

After few years of struggling with dtsearch perfomance on our 300gb document archive, we decided to create our own solution. You can then customise the result templates to fit in with the rest of your site if applicable. Indexing scanned pdf files firstly forgive me if there is already a post about this, i did do a search but didnt come up with anything. I have been having problems indexing pdf files on a drupal 8 site i am working on using the search api module. Select all pdf documents in and then choose your pdf folder. How can i ensure that the file list that is displayed when searching in an index contains only the filenames. Office pdf document indexing simpleindex uses the existing text of microsoft office documents word, excel, powerpoint, etc. It creates a transparent wordbased index to smooth the search, add a relevance, make meta fields and attachment files searchable by their content and even more. I came accross the php pdf class but i cant seem to find any function for readingsearching a filestream. When these files have been specified, you can then let your reliable application do the rest of the work for you. In this tutorial you will learn how to force download a file using php. Installing adobe acrobat reader is a better method to view these types of documents if no browser plugins are installed. Read pdf file in php this tutorial provides you easy steps to read pdf file in php.

Pdf ifilter supports indexing of iso 320001 which based upon pdf 1. If you liked this article or have questions about extracting and searching text from document files, post a comment here. Thanks the indexing of pdf files and their contents is now working fine. Documents that have been scanned into the selected inbasket are displayed along with the fields that were set up for the selected database.

Free trial download evaluate foxits pdf ifilter with a free trial download and discover how quickly and easily you can search for pdf documents with the industrys best pdf ifilter product. Pdf index generator is a powerful indexing utility for generating an index from your book and writing it to your book in 4 easy steps. Text finding is the best free content search software that can perform fulltext content search in many types of files, including pdf, word, excel, html, outlook express, text, and many more. Download and install pdftotext and catdoc and set there locationpath in conf.

171 1195 152 769 1148 1237 1097 821 306 604 264 1323 15 539 1037 1131 1188 984 768 1045 1029 180 193 30 1250 607 227 990 1450